Shiyali Ramamrita Ranganathan & the Colon Classification System

Life & Achievements (1892-1972):
 Education:
    Madras Christian College (Madras): Mathematics BA 1913, MA 1916
    Teachers College (Saidapet): Teaching License 1917
    University of London, School of Librarianship: Honors Certificate 1925
 A Few Achievements:
    First librarian at Madras University
    Responsible for the reorganization of Indian Libraries
    Founder of the Madras Library Association
    Co-founder Indian Library Association
    Founder of the Documentation Research and Training Center in Bangalore
    Author of several books and other works
 Contributions to Library Community:
    The term “Library Science”
    Library Administration and Management
    Reference Service
    The Five Laws
    The Colon Classification

Shiyali Ramamrita Ranganathan & the Colon Classification System

The Five Laws of Library Science:
                           1. Books are for use
                           2. Every reader his or her book
                           3. Every book its reader
                           4. Save the time of the reader
                           5. The library is a growing organism

Shiyali Ramamrita Ranganathan & the Colon Classification System

Advantages and Disadvantages:
 Advantages of the Colon Classification:
        Very flexible
        Able to easily accommodate new scientific discoveries, intellectual
         innovations, & cultural developments
        Provides detailed and accurate subject classification
        Recognizes that hierarchical arrangements are not always adequate


 Disadvantages of the Colon Classification:
        Extremely complex system
        Time consuming subject analysis and description
        Results in very long call numbers (L,45;421:6;253:f.44'N5 = 22 characters!!)

Shiyali Ramamrita Ranganathan & the Colon Classification System

The Legacy of Colon Classification (CC):
 Colon Classification is not widespread in libraries
 CC has strongly influenced other classification schemes; most
  major systems (although not LCC) now include at least some
  aspects of a faceted system
 Faceted classification systems are increasing in popularity for
  electronic resources
        Epicurious.com
        Yahoo! Directory search
        del.icio.us & Connotea.org
        Efforts at MIT to create a self-guiding eResources portal
